Why Choose Etsy for Selling Digital Products?
Etsy is a powerhouse for handmade and vintage items, but did you know it’s also a goldmine for digital creators? Think about it: no inventory, no shipping costs, pure profit potential. Etsy offers a built-in audience actively searching for unique digital goods. From printable wall art to social media templates, the possibilities are endless.

Optimizing Your Etsy Shop for Success
Etsy SEO is a game-changer. Just like Google, Etsy has its own search algorithm. To get your products seen, you need to master the art of keyword research, compelling product titles, and detailed descriptions. Think like a buyer. What keywords would *you* use to search for your products? Incorporate those keywords naturally throughout your listings.

Pricing Your Digital Products Strategically
Pricing can be tricky. Research your competitors, consider your production costs (if any), and factor in the perceived value of your products. Don’t undervalue your work! Experiment with different pricing strategies to find what works best for you.
Marketing Your Etsy Shop Like a Pro
Social media is your best friend. Showcase your products, engage with your followers, and run targeted ads. Consider offering discounts and promotions to attract new customers. Collaborating with other Etsy sellers can also expand your reach and introduce you to a new audience.
Providing Excellent Customer Service
Respond promptly to customer inquiries, address any issues quickly and professionally, and go the extra mile whenever possible. Positive reviews are gold. They build trust and social proof, which can significantly impact your sales.
Staying Organized and Managing Your Time
Running an Etsy shop can be demanding, especially if you’re juggling other commitments. Develop a system for managing your orders, tracking your inventory (if applicable), and responding to customer inquiries. Time management is key to avoiding burnout and maintaining a healthy work-life balance.
FAQ: Your Burning Questions Answered
What types of digital products can I sell on Etsy?
Almost anything! Printables, templates, graphics, patterns, fonts, courses, and more. The possibilities are vast.
How do I get paid on Etsy?
Etsy Payments allows you to accept various payment methods, and funds are typically deposited directly into your bank account.
What are Etsy’s fees?
Etsy charges listing fees, transaction fees, and payment processing fees. Be sure to familiarize yourself with their fee structure.
Can I sell digital products I didn’t create myself?
No, you must own the intellectual property rights to any digital products you sell on Etsy.
How do I prevent my digital products from being illegally copied?
While complete prevention is difficult, you can add watermarks, disclaimers, and terms of use to deter unauthorized sharing.
